What is a Portable Power Station?

A portable power station is a compact device that stores energy from various sources, such as solar panels, wind turbines, or generators. It works by converting the stored energy into usable electricity, which can power a wide range of devices, from smartphones and laptops to refrigerators and power tools. Portable power stations are designed to be lightweight and easy to transport, making them ideal for off-grid living, camping, or emergency situations.

How Does a Portable Power Station Work?

Portable power stations typically consist of a battery, an inverter, and a charge controller. The battery stores the energy generated by the solar panels or other sources, while the inverter converts the DC (direct current) energy into AC (alternating current) energy, which is the type of electricity used in most household appliances. The charge controller regulates the flow of energy between the battery and the solar panels, ensuring that the battery is charged efficiently and safely.

In the previous section, I introduced how to use AB glue. Put A glue and B glue in a dual glue cartridge according to a certain ratio, and then mix AB glue with a static mixer tube, and use it to the place where it needs to be glued. But many times, we will make operational mistakes. How to remove the AB glue after curing?

3 ways to remove AB glue after curing 1. Both epoxy ab glue and acrylic ab glue are hard and brittle after curing, especially epoxy ab glue, it is easy to break under the action of external force, we can use this ab glue when removing ab glue Characteristic. When the ab glue is broken by an external force, the two objects bonded by the ab glue can naturally be separated. However, this method is only suitable for objects that can withstand external percussion. For example, ceramics cannot use this method, and The separated ab glue needs to be cleaned by other methods;

  1. Each chemical raw material used in the production of ab glue has a corresponding chemical solvent that can melt, so the cured ab glue also has a corresponding debonding agent that can melt the glue, but the ab glue itself has good solvent resistance after curing. It is resistant to acid and alkali, and is not easy to be corroded, which means that the ab glue dissolving agent is very corrosive. When using ab glue dissolving agent to remove ab glue, you need to be very careful to avoid harm to the human body. At the same time, the debonding agent of ab glue may also corrode objects, so this method of removing ab glue is not recommended;

  2. The high temperature resistance of most ab glues is about 100 degrees. In fact, when the temperature reaches a certain height, even if the ab glue is still attached to the object, its strength will drop a lot. It is easy to separate the two objects, so The ab glue can be removed by warming the ab glue to soften it. At the same time, the ab glue left on the parts that have been separated by breaking the ab glue mentioned above can also be completely removed by this method. This method of removing ab glue is suitable for large Some objects, only some objects that cannot withstand high temperatures cannot be used, such as plastics that are easily deformed at high temperatures.

What is an Epoxy Mixing Nozzle? Definition An epoxy mixing nozzle is a specialized component designed to facilitate the accurate and thorough mixing of epoxy resins. These nozzles are commonly used in conjunction with dual-cartridge dispensing systems, where two separate epoxy components are stored in distinct chambers within the cartridge.

Construction Typically made from high-quality plastic or metal, epoxy mixing nozzles are engineered to withstand the chemical reactions that occur during the epoxy curing process. They feature a helical or static mixing element, which ensures that the two epoxy components are thoroughly blended as they pass through the nozzle.

How Epoxy Mixing Nozzles Work Dual-Cartridge Systems The dual-cartridge system is a widely adopted method for dispensing epoxy. It involves two separate chambers within the cartridge, each containing one component of the epoxy resin. The epoxy mixing nozzle is attached to the cartridge, and as the epoxy is dispensed, the two components are forced through the nozzle's mixing element.

Mixing Element Designs Epoxy mixing nozzles can have either static or dynamic mixing elements. Static mixers feature fixed blades that divide and recombine the epoxy components as they pass through. Dynamic mixers, on the other hand, have a helical design that creates a swirling motion, ensuring thorough mixing.

Efficient Dispensing The key advantage of epoxy mixing nozzles lies in their ability to deliver a homogenous blend of epoxy components directly onto the bonding surfaces. This ensures that the epoxy cures uniformly, enhancing the overall strength and reliability of the bonded joint.

Advantages of Using Epoxy Mixing Nozzles Precision Epoxy mixing nozzles provide a high level of precision in the blending process. The design of the mixing element ensures that the epoxy components are combined in the correct proportions, minimizing the risk of uneven curing and weak bonds.

Reduced Waste By allowing for on-the-fly mixing and dispensing, epoxy mixing nozzles help reduce waste. Users can dispense only the amount of epoxy needed for a specific application, avoiding excess material that might go unused and be wasted.

Time Efficiency The integration of epoxy mixing nozzles with dual-cartridge systems streamlines the application process, saving time for users. The simultaneous mixing and dispensing of epoxy simplify tasks and contribute to overall project efficiency.

Choosing the Right Epoxy Mixing Nozzle When selecting an epoxy mixing nozzle, several factors should be considered:

Compatibility Ensure that the nozzle is compatible with the specific epoxy formulation you are using. Different epoxies may have varying viscosities and curing times, requiring specific mixing elements for optimal results.

Size and Configuration Select a mixing nozzle size and configuration that suits the application at hand. The nozzle should allow for easy access to the bonding surfaces and provide the desired dispensing rate.

Material Compatibility Check the material of the mixing nozzle for compatibility with the epoxy components. Some formulations may require nozzles made from specific materials to prevent chemical reactions that could compromise the epoxy curing process.

Maintenance and Storage Proper maintenance of epoxy mixing nozzles is essential for their longevity and effectiveness. After use, it is advisable to purge the nozzle by dispensing a small amount of epoxy to prevent curing within the mixing element. Additionally, storing nozzles in a cool, dry place away from direct sunlight helps preserve their integrity.

Understanding Cast Net Sizes

Cast nets come in various sizes, typically measured in radius or diameter. The size you choose depends on the type of fish you are targeting and the fishing environment. Larger cast nets are suitable for catching bigger fish in open waters, while smaller cast nets are ideal for shallow areas or targeting smaller fish.

It's important to note that cast net sizes can vary across different regions and fishing practices. However, the principles we discuss here will help you make an informed decision regardless of your location.

Factors to Consider

Fish Species

The first factor to consider when choosing a cast net size is the species of fish you are targeting. Different fish have different sizes and behaviors, so it's essential to select a net that matches their characteristics. For example, if you are targeting larger fish like redfish or snook, a larger cast net with a wider spread will be more effective. On the other hand, if you are targeting smaller fish like baitfish or shrimp, a smaller net will suffice.

Fishing Environment

The fishing environment also plays a significant role in determining the appropriate cast net size. If you are fishing in open waters with strong currents, a larger net will help you cover a wider area and increase your chances of a successful catch. In contrast, if you are fishing in shallow areas or near structures, a smaller net will be more maneuverable and less likely to get tangled.

Net Material

The material of the cast net can affect its performance and durability. Most cast nets are made of monofilament or nylon, each with its own advantages. Monofilament nets are more transparent and less likely to spook fish, making them suitable for clear water conditions. Nylon nets, on the other hand, are more durable and can withstand rougher fishing environments. Consider the pros and cons of each material and choose the one that best suits your fishing needs.
